
Gladiators Garnet and Gold Goes "Pink" this Weekend

The Gwinnett Gladiators 5th Annual "Pink in the Rink" charity fundraiser and cancer awareness event is set for this weekend, Friday, March 2nd, Saturday, March 3rd and Sunday, March 4th as the Gladiators continue their traditional "March To The Playoffs" with back-to-back-to-back matchups featuring two games against Trenton and a key battle against division-rival South Carolina.
"Pink in the Rink" is the Gladiators highest-profile annual fundraising effort, netting over $225,000 to benefit numerous local cancer-related entities in North Georgia during the first four editions of the "Pink in the Rink" weekend. This season, the Gladiators have teamed up with "The Sport of Giving" and the American Cancer Society's "Relay for Life" as the primary beneficaries of the 3-game "Pink in the Rink" weekend event. These and other organizations pre-sold specially designated fundraising tickets with a portion of the admission price allocated to benefit their specific cause. In addition, each participating charitable organization shares the opportunity to receive a portion of the proceeds generated as a part of various team-sponsored fundraising activities associated with "Pink In The Rink".
In what has become a local sensation and fan favorite, the Gladiators will skate on a pink ice surface during the games over the weekend. It will be the fourth consecutive season that the Gladiators will skate on pink ice, and the fifth time in team history that the team has skated on colored ice during a home game. (The ice was dyed green for St. Patrick's Day on March 17th during the 2006-07 season.) The Gwinnett Center Ice Crew, led by Primary Zamboni Driver and Lead Ice Technician Ryan Guley, will conduct the intricate operations required to colorize the pink ice on Thursday, March 1st.
Fans who wish to participate and make a donation to the Gladiators fundraising efforts will have the opportunity to stop by any one of the tables reserved for participating organizations on the main concourse. In addition, the Gladiators will feature a variety of of official commemorative "Pink in the Rink" team merchandise and apparel throughout the weekend with a portion of the proceeds from each sale going towards the fundraising effort.
In addition, a portion of the proceeds of the Gladiators annual Specialty Jersey Auction will be included in the fundraising efforts earmarked to benefit "Pink in the Rink" fundraising efforts. This season, the live Specialty Jersey Auction will be held following the Gladiators final regular season home game of the year on Saturday, February 17th, during which the players will wear the one-off design jerseys featuring a unique tartan-plaid St. Patrick's Day theme.
The Gladiators are the ECHL Affiliate of the Buffalo Sabres and the Phoenix Coyotes of the National Hockey League and are members of the ECHL, the Premier "AA" Hockey League and play all home games at the 11,355-seat Arena at Gwinnett Center, located just off I-85 on Sugarloaf Parkway in Duluth.
